Geese make up peculiar families within the herd with several females and one male. This circumstance pleases poultry farmers, since for the sake of reproduction of the livestock, it is not necessary to feed an extra bird in vain for several years. How many geese should be left for one gander so that he is satisfied and at the same time not exhausted? What factors influence its effectiveness?

How many geese, on average, should be left for one gander?

This question cannot be answered unambiguously. In addition to the fact that the owner is inclined to leave the best individuals for the tribe, the geese themselves actively participate in the selection.A certain role in the formation of the parent herd is played by the relationships that have developed in it. According to statistics, the number of females for one gander ranges from 1 to 5. But at successful moments in life, the male also covers 8-10 individuals of the opposite sex. This pace does not last long, as it exhausts the gander. For a permanent relationship, he stays with his favorites.

To appreciate a gander, you need to watch him. After all, there are individuals who are satisfied with one girlfriend. Fertility is inherited by the manufacturer. Therefore, having several young males in the herd, the owner takes a closer look at who pays more attention to the opposite sex.

Factors affecting quantity

Research has shown that male sexual behavior has causes that can often be corrected by the owner. These include:

  • age;
  • breed;
  • food;
  • containment conditions;
  • herd relations;
  • adding new individuals to the group.

Ganders become capable of breeding from 7 months. They can choose among females older than 8 months and up to 4-6 years. The owner selects older geese for slaughter. The male remains sexually active for 3-4 years.

Ganders of heavy meat breeds are not particularly interested in the opposite sex. 2-3 females they trample on is a good indicator. It happens that there are no ganders in the herd that come into contact with more than 1 female. If you don’t want to feed a lot of them in vain, they buy active ones in another farm, having personally checked their abilities.

But here the factor of hostile relations in the herd may come into play. A stronger gander may keep competitors away from females, although he himself is not able to spud such a number of livestock in his personal harem. The situation in the herd is calm if all the males grew up together.

Then there is a problem with family ties, leading to degeneration and even deformities. Every 3 years, when changing ganders, one has to resort to strangers acquired, preferably in another area. Otherwise, you will have to change all the geese, which is more expensive. Although, at the same time, calmness in the herd would have been preserved, and the activity of the ganders at the sight of new ones would have increased. Some of them could be sent for meat.

The diet of he althy birds is balanced. Well-being affects the reproductive functions of the body. Also, additives stimulating the production and activity of spermatozoa, such as chlorella suspension, are added to the feed. It can be found in the composition of feed. Free access to the reservoir also increases the vitality of geese.
